    Abstract: Network servers in a session initiation protocol (SIP) telecommunication network implement playback of announcements to end-users by embedding programming scripts defining how the announcements are to be played in a SIP message. In particular, the scripts may define the sequence in which a series of announcements are to be played, duration information relating to a playback length of the announcements, and repetition information defining how many times an announcement is to be repeated. By including a script in a single message, announcement instructions may be efficiently communicated in the network.

    Abstract: The present invention provides a system and method for providing certified voice and/or multimedia mail messages in a broadband signed communication system which uses packetized digital information. Cryptography is used to authenticate a message that has been compiled from streaming voice or multimedia packets. A certificate of the originator's identity and electronic signature authenticates the message. A broadband communication system user may be provisioned for certified voice and/or multimedia mail by registering with a certified mail service provider and thereby receiving certification. The called system user's CPE electronically signs the bits in received communication packets and returns the message with an electronic signature of the called system user to the calling party, along with the system user's certificate obtained from the service provider/certifying authority during registration. The electronic signature is a cryptographic key of the called party.

    Abstract: A system and method for interfacing unified message processing systems with legacy voice mail, e-mail and facsimile systems, located behind corporate firewalls. The system includes a unified message server, a proxy interface and a message protocol convertor. The proxy interface is configured to access the legacy system in response to a request from a unified message server. Messages stored on the legacy system are converted by a protocol convertor to a predetermined format compatible with the unified message server. The converted messages are then transferred to a unified message server which is capable of providing messages from different messaging system, such as voice mail, e-mail and facsimile to users in a predetermined format. The invention permits enterprise wide communication systems to provide unified messaging without abandoning pre-existing legacy messaging system.

    Abstract: Voicemail is received at a voicemail server and converted to an audio file format; it is then sent or streamed over a wide area network to a voice to text transcription system comprising a network of computers. One of the networked computers plays back the voice message to an operator and the operator intelligently transcribes the actual message from the original voice message by entering the corresponding text message (actually a succinct version of the original voice message, not a verbose word-for-word conversion) into the computer to generate a transcribed text message. The transcribed text message is then sent to the wireless information device from the computer. Because human operators are used instead of machine transcription, voicemails are converted accurately, intelligently, appropriately and succinctly into text messages (SMS/MMS).

    Abstract: Disclosed are systems and techniques by which a caller may specify a callee's telephone number and be connected directly to a carrier provided voice mail facility associated with the identified the telephone number, even though the callee's carrier may not be the same as the caller's carrier. In the disclosed technique, a telephony server places a “Send a call” request to a server which then sends a signaling call that busies out the channel associated with the callee. The telephony server places a second call (the actual voice message) upon confirmation that the signaling call has been initiated, forcing the second call to the carrier's voice mail facility associated with the callee, since the first signaling call busied the first channel. Prior to sending the signaling call, a database look up is performed to determine which carrier services the callee number. Once the carrier is determined, another memory look up is performed to determine the time delay associated with that carrier.

    Abstract: A method for accessing and browsing the internet through the use of a telephone and the associated DTMF signals is disclosed. The preferred embodiment provides a system that converts the information content of a web page from text to speech (voice signals), signals the hyperlink selections of a web page in an audio manner, and allows selection of the hyperlinks through the use of DTMF signals generated from a telephone keypad. Upon receiving a DTMF signal corresponding to a hyperlink, the corresponding web page is fetched and again delivered to the user via one of the available delivery methods such as voice, fax-on-demand, electronic mail, or regular mail.

    Abstract: Described is automatically testing the quality of an audio channel between a caller and a callee that includes a device under test, such as a VoIP or other gateway. An analyzer receives timestamps from a caller and callee during a calling session, including timestamps for when the callee initially provides audio (e.g., speech) to the caller, when the caller initially detects sound, when the caller initially provides audio to the callee, and when the callee initially detects sound. The analyzer uses the relative timing of the timestamps and the speech recognizer's outcome to determine whether the audio channel is experiencing interference or echo. When the audio includes speech, a confidence level corresponding to accuracy of speech recognition also may establish the audio channel's quality. Random selection and timing of output may be employed, such as to vary the testing patterns during repetitive tests.
